vue.jsHow do Vue.js and jQuery compare in terms of software development?
Vue.js and jQuery are two of the most popular JavaScript libraries used for software development. While jQuery is a library focused on manipulating the DOM, Vue.js is a framework that provides the structure for developing web applications.
jQuery offers a wide range of features for DOM manipulation including traversal, events, animation, and Ajax. It's easy to use and can be quickly implemented. For example, the following code uses jQuery to select all the paragraphs on the page and add a class to them:
$('p').addClass('text-primary');
Vue.js, on the other hand, provides an organized structure for building web applications. It provides a component-based architecture and reactive data binding, allowing developers to create powerful and interactive user interfaces. For example, the following code uses Vue.js to create a simple component that displays a message:
<div id="app">
{{ message }}
</div>
<script>
new Vue({
el: '#app',
data: {
message: 'Hello, Vue!'
}
})
</script>
Output example
Hello, Vue!
In conclusion, Vue.js and jQuery are both popular libraries for software development, but they offer different features and approaches. While jQuery is great for DOM manipulation, Vue.js provides an organized structure for creating web applications.
Helpful links
More of Vue.js
- How can I implement pinch zoom functionality in a Vue.js project?
- How to use a YAML editor with Vue.js?
- How do I use the v-model in Vue.js?
- How do I install Vue.js?
- How do I set a z-index in Vue.js?
- How do I install Yarn with Vue.js?
- How do I use Yup with Vue.js?
- How can I convert XML data to JSON using Vue.js?
- How can I use Vue and Chart.js to add zoom functionality to my chart?
- How can I integrate Vue.js with Yii2?
See more codes...